  1. Catherine Sue Opie (born 1961) [1] is an American fine art photographer and educator. She lives and works in Los Angeles, [2] as a professor of photography at the University of California, Los Angeles. [3] [4] Opie studies the connections between mainstream and infrequent society.

  5. Catherine Opie (American, b.1961) is acclaimed for her arresting portraits and landscapes, which examine notions of gender, sexuality, and the fabric of American communities in technically-refined works with rich color.
